You are right. The TLB handlers for 8xx in arch/powerpc branch set the
PAGE_ACCESSED flag unconditionally too. And the
include/asm-powerpc/pgtable-ppc32.h file still includes the comment that this
is the bug. So, probably the corresponding patch for powerpc branch will be
usefull. Does anybody use swap with some of the 8xx-based boards supported in
powerpc branch ?
